    Our Learning Experience Specialist will be part of a leading-edge learning strategy team responsible for the creation of blended-learning solutions and transformational strategies that align with the strategic objectives of Astreya Programs and their top key clients.
    This role will primarily focus on content development, storyboarding, blended learning design, and enhancing a diverse array of learning solutions for the purpose of improving the performance of employees within functional groups of Astreya.
    The focus of this work is designing and developing learning and practicing experiences in support of multiple positions for all functions across the organization. This role creates engaging learning activities and interactive course content that attracts, develops and retains valued employees. Through consultative relationships with key stakeholders, this role will assess and develop learning content requirements and conduct needs assessments. This role has primary accountability of determining the proper blend of instructor-led, hands-on, and eLearning training to be used in a given solution that supports the overall Learning strategy within the organization.

    Your Roles and Responsibilities:
    • Develops a consultative relationship with key stakeholders and subject-matter-experts to assess and develop learning content requirements.
    • Partners with Program Management and subject matter experts to identify new learning needs, map them to the appropriate competencies, obtain source information and validate courseware content.
    • Coordinate with internal partners to develop assessments to measure learning impact.
    • Coordinate implementation of the newly developed curriculum with internal customers.
    • Participate in creation of engaging learning activities and compelling course content that enhances retention and transfer of performance.
    • Apply tested instructional design theories, practices, and methods.
    • Determine the proper blend of instructor-led, hands-on, and eLearning training to be used in a given solution.
    • Design and develop innovative learning methodologies such as case studies, engaging stories, motivating scenarios and gamification to reflect the content, audience, and business needs.
